TS EAMCET · Maths · Complex Number

The product of the distinct \((2 n)\) th roots of \(1+i \sqrt{3}\) is equal to :

  1. A 0
  2. B \(-1-i \sqrt{3}\)
  3. C \(1+i \sqrt{3}\)
  4. D \(-1+i \sqrt{3}\)
Verified Solution

Answer & Solution

Correct Answer

(B) \(-1-i \sqrt{3}\)

Step-by-step Solution

Detailed explanation

Product of the distinct \((2 n)^{\text {th }}\) roots of \(1+i \sqrt{3}\) \(=-1-i \sqrt{3}\)
